A MAJOR CAUSE OF THE NURSING HOME NEGLECT EPIDEMIC

Unfortunately, one of the main reasons we have found for nursing home abuse and neglect is improper training or not enough staffing. It is difficult to make sure all the patients get enough care if there is not enough people to help them. If you are considering a Cookeville nursing home for your loved one then it is a good idea to ask questions about training procedures, how many staff they are for each resident and how often they are checked on throughout the day and night. If someone you care about is already living in a nursing home, one of the best things you can do for them is to visit them often. This way you can check for any signs of abuse or neglect such as: your loved one has sores, cuts, or bruises that may be new or are not healing properly. It is also advised to notice if your loved one is acting differently. If they are worried, scared, or seem withdrawn, this is often a sign that something is wrong. You should talk with the nursing home about your concerns. You can ask to speak to the supervisor or owner of the nursing home about the situation. If they do not seem to be doing anything to properly handle the problem, then you should contact the Tennessee Department of Health about your concerns.
